Hackers design worms and viruses such as MyDoom and others typically to spread through a backdoor to infected computers, which in turn causes these computers to take some action, such as searching Google for the email addresses of unsuspecting recipients, which results in an even more widespread attack.
The OptimIP Port Lockdown Authority collects information from learning-based monitoring of unusual network traffic or through security community alerts. Armed with this information, the OptimIP system can then automatically or interactively "lockdown" activity to the suspected "Port" of entry, such as Port 1034 in the case of the MyDoom virus, on any or all computers on the internal business network. According to the recently released "Insider Threat Study: Illicit Cyber Activity in the Banking and Finance Sector," conducted by Carnegie Mellon University in conjunction with the Secret Service National Threat Assessment Center, "Insiders pose a substantial security threat by virtue of their knowledge of and access to their employers' systems and/or databases, and their ability to bypass existing physical and electronic security measures through legitimate means." In 30 percent of the cases studied, the financial loss was in excess of $500,000. In one case, the perpetrator caused a bank to lose over $600 million. In another case, a company impacted by a "logic bomb," consisting of malicious code triggered after a designated time or specified system action, sustained a loss of approximately $3 million.
